THE COUNCIL OF THE EUROPEAN UNION,
Having regard to the Treaty on the Functioning of the European Union, and in particular the first subparagraph of Article 207(4), in conjunction with Article 218(9), thereof,
Having regard to the proposal from the European Commission,
Whereas:
(1) Article 15a of the Convention of 20 May 1987 on a common transit procedure(1) (the ‘Convention’) allows for a third country to become a Contracting Party to the Convention following a decision of the Joint Committee set up by the Convention to invite the country.
(2) Article 15 of the Convention empowers the Joint Committee to recommend and adopt, by decisions, amendments to the Convention and the Appendices thereto.
(3) Turkey formally expressed its wish to join the common transit system and has been invited following a decision by the Joint Committee on 19 January 2012.
(4) Having satisfied the essential legal, structural and information technology requirements which are preconditions for accession, and following the formal procedure for accession, Turkey will accede to the Convention.
(5) The enlargement of the common transit system will require certain amendments to the Convention. These concern new linguistic references in Turkish and the appropriate adaptations to guarantee documents.
(6) The proposed amendment was presented to and discussed within the EU-EFTA Working Group and the text received preliminary approval.
(7) Therefore, the position of the European Union concerning the proposed amendment should be determined,
HAS ADOPTED THIS DECISION:
